Material Quality and Durability
Choosing the right powerlifting belt hinges on its material quality and durability, as these factors directly impact its performance and lifespan. High-quality leather, like full-grain or genuine leather, provides long-lasting support and stands up to intense lifting sessions without quickly showing wear. Reinforced stitching, double seams, and heavy-duty construction prevent fraying and keep the belt structurally sound over time. The thickness of the leather, usually between 6mm and 13mm, influences support and stiffness, affecting safety during heavy lifts. Well-tanned and processed leather resists cracking, stretching, and fading, maintaining its look and function for years. Additionally, the type of leather impacts flexibility and comfort, with softer options offering easier break-in and thicker materials providing maximum stability.
Proper Fit and Sizing
A proper fit is essential for a powerlifting belt to deliver the support you need during heavy lifts. I recommend measuring around your lower back over your belly button, not relying on pant size, to get an accurate waist measurement. The belt should be snug but comfortable, allowing you to breathe and move freely. If it’s too tight, it can restrict your breathing and hinder movement; too loose, and it won’t provide enough support, increasing injury risk. Always check the manufacturer’s sizing chart, as most base sizes on waist circumference. A well-fitting belt should sit securely without pinching or chafing, enabling you to generate proper intra-abdominal pressure and stay stable during lifts. Proper fit is key to maximizing both safety and effectiveness.
Support Level Needed
The support level of a leather powerlifting belt largely depends on its thickness, with 10mm to 13mm belts providing the maximum stability needed for heavy lifts. Thicker belts generate greater intra-abdominal pressure and spinal stabilization, which helps prevent injuries during intense exercises like squats and deadlifts. However, the support you need also depends on your experience and lifting goals. Beginners typically require less support, while advanced lifters pushing near their maximum capacity benefit from thicker, reinforced belts that maintain shape and tension through repeated use. Reinforced stitching and durable leather further enhance support by ensuring the belt maintains its effectiveness over time. Ultimately, selecting the right support level involves balancing enough stabilization with comfort and mobility for your specific lifting needs.

What Is the Optimal Width for Powerlifting Belts?
Think of a powerlifting belt like a suit of armor—width matters. I recommend an ideal width of about 4 inches, as it provides excellent support while allowing for comfortable movement. Going wider can restrict mobility, and narrower belts might not offer enough stability. This balance helps you lift safely and effectively, much like a well-crafted shield, ensuring you stay protected under heavy loads.
